Job Description

Rx relief is seeking an experienced Pharmacy Technician to support a leading 503B Outsourcing Facility.

Qualifications:

  • Active New York Pharmacist Technician license
  • 3+ years’ experience in a 503B, hospital compounding, or cGMP-regulated setting
  • Strong understanding of FDA, DEA, and state regulations
  • Experience with QMS and controlled substance compliance
  • Knowledge of pharmaceutical terminology, medications, and compounding techniques
  • Understanding of sterile compounding procedures and aseptic technique

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and compound sterile and non-sterile pharmaceutical preparations according to established protocols and safety standards
  • Accurately measure, mix, and package medications following physician orders and pharmacy specifications
  • Maintain detailed production records and documentation to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ements
  • Operate and maintain pharmacy production equipment, including automated dispensing systems and compounding tools
  • Perform quality control checks on all prepared medications to ensure accuracy and safety
  • Follow USP guidelines and maintain aseptic technique when preparing sterile products
  • Organize and stock pharmacy inventory, ensuring proper storage conditions and rotation of medications
  • Clean and sanitize work areas, equipment, and production facilities according to established procedures
  • Collaborate with pharmacists and other team members to ensure efficient workflow and timely production
  • Assist in training new technicians on production processes and safety protocols
  • Monitor expiration dates and remove outdated medications from inventory
  • Maintain a clean and organized work environment in compliance with safety regulations
